The True Tale
What be the true tale of blackbeard true story on the high seas?
The true tale, stripped bare of the romanticism, is one of calculated ambition and ruthless efficiency. Edward Teach, as he was born, started as a privateer during Queen Anne's War, a loyal servant of the crown. But the lure of easy riches and the thrill of the chase proved too strong. He turned pirate, quickly rising through the ranks thanks to his intelligence and audacity. Blackbeard true story on the high seas became one of terror and power. He wasn't just robbing ships. He was building an empire, a network of alliances and informants that stretched across the Caribbean. He knew how to exploit weaknesses, how to manipulate the fears of his enemies. For a brief period, he blockaded Charleston, South Carolina, holding the entire city ransom. It was a display of power that sent shockwaves throughout the colonies. But his reign was short-lived. He accepted a pardon from the Governor of North Carolina, but his thirst for adventure proved too strong. He returned to piracy, attracting the attention of Lieutenant Robert Maynard of the Royal Navy. Maynard ambushed Blackbeard off the coast of Ocracoke Island, ending his reign in a bloody battle. However, the end of the story did not end the myth.
